Split One Row in to Two Rows in SQL - sql

I have a table with below columns
PAX_NO | AMOUNT_ONE | AMOUNT_TWO | PAX_NO_LASTYEAR | AMOUNT_ONE_LASTYEAR | AMOUNT_TWO_LASTYEAR
45 | 56.54 | 43.23 | 23 | 23.43 | 78.43
69 | 21.11 | 51.19 | 20 | 11.23 | 55.99
I need to get it as below
PAX_NO | AMOUNT_ONE | AMOUNT_TWO
45 | 56.54 | 43.23
23 | 23.43 | 78.43
69 | 21.11 | 51.19
20 | 11.23 | 55.99

You can just use UNION ALL:
SELECT pax_no, amount_one, amount_two FROM your_table
UNION ALL
SELECT PAX_NO_LASTYEAR, AMOUNT_ONE_LASTYEAR, AMOUNT_TWO_LASTYEAR FROM your_table;

Running total SQL server - AGAIN

i'm aware that this question has been asked multiple times and I have read those threads to get to where I am now, but those solutions don't seem to be working. I need to have a running total of my ExpectedAmount...
I have the following table:
+--------------+----------------+
| ExpectedDate | ExpectedAmount |
+--------------+----------------+
| 1 | 2485513 |
| 2 | 526032 |
| 3 | 342041 |
| 4 | 195807 |
| 5 | 380477 |
| 6 | 102233 |
| 7 | 539951 |
| 8 | 107145 |
| 10 | 165110 |
| 11 | 18795 |
| 12 | 27177 |
| 13 | 28232 |
| 14 | 154631 |
| 15 | 5566585 |
| 16 | 250814 |
| 17 | 90444 |
| 18 | 105424 |
| 19 | 62132 |
| 20 | 1799349 |
| 21 | 303131 |
| 22 | 459464 |
| 23 | 723488 |
| 24 | 676514 |
| 25 | 17311911 |
| 26 | 4876062 |
| 27 | 4844434 |
| 28 | 4039687 |
| 29 | 1418648 |
| 30 | 4366189 |
| 31 | 9028836 |
+--------------+----------------+
I have the following SQL:
SELECT a.ExpectedDate, a.ExpectedAmount, (SELECT SUM(b.ExpectedAmount)
FROM UnpaidManagement..Expected b
WHERE b.ExpectedDate <= a.ExpectedDate)
FROM UnpaidManagement..Expected a
The result of the above SQL is this:
+--------------+----------------+--------------+
| ExpectedDate | ExpectedAmount | RunningTotal |
+--------------+----------------+--------------+
| 1 | 2485513 | 2485513 |
| 2 | 526032 | 9480889 |
| 3 | 342041 | 46275618 |
| 4 | 195807 | 59866450 |
| 5 | 380477 | 60246927 |
| 6 | 102233 | 60349160 |
| 7 | 539951 | 60889111 |
| 8 | 107145 | 60996256 |
| 10 | 165110 | 2650623 |
| 11 | 18795 | 2669418 |
| 12 | 27177 | 2696595 |
| 13 | 28232 | 2724827 |
| 14 | 154631 | 2879458 |
| 15 | 5566585 | 8446043 |
| 16 | 250814 | 8696857 |
| 17 | 90444 | 8787301 |
| 18 | 105424 | 8892725 |
| 19 | 62132 | 8954857 |
| 20 | 1799349 | 11280238 |
| 21 | 303131 | 11583369 |
| 22 | 459464 | 12042833 |
| 23 | 723488 | 12766321 |
| 24 | 676514 | 13442835 |
| 25 | 17311911 | 30754746 |
| 26 | 4876062 | 35630808 |
| 27 | 4844434 | 40475242 |
| 28 | 4039687 | 44514929 |
| 29 | 1418648 | 45933577 |
| 30 | 4366189 | 50641807 |
| 31 | 9028836 | 59670643 |
+--------------+----------------+--------------+
You can tell from the first few values already that the math is all off, but then at some points the math adds up?! I'm Too confused !! Could someone please point me to another solution or to where I have gone wrong with this?
I am using SQL Server 2008.
It is because your ExpectedDate column of type varchar. Try this:
SELECT a.ExpectedDate, a.ExpectedAmount, (SELECT SUM(b.ExpectedAmount)
FROM UnpaidManagement..Expected b
WHERE CAST(b.ExpectedDate as int) <= CAST(a.ExpectedDate as int))
FROM UnpaidManagement..Expected a
Note that it could be inefficient query.
I think this gonna work:
SELECT a.ExpectedDate,
a.ExpectedAmount,
SUM(b.ExpectedAmount) RuningTotal
FROM UnpaidManagement..Expected a
LEFT JOIN UnpaidManagement..Expected b
ON CAST(b.ExpectedDate as int) <= CAST(a.ExpectedDate as int)
GROUP BY a.ExpectedDate, a.ExpectedAmount
AND:
SELECT a.ExpectedDate,
a.ExpectedAmount,
c.RuningTotal
FROM UnpaidManagement..Expected a
CROSS APPLY (
SELECT SUM(b.ExpectedAmount) AS RuningTotal
FROM UnpaidManagement..Expected b
WHERE CAST(b.ExpectedDate as int) <= CAST(a.ExpectedDate as int)
) c

MySQL Sum one field based on a second 'common' field

Not a SQL guy, so i'm in a bind, so I'll keep this simple
+--------------+------------------------+
| RepaymentDay | MonthlyRepaymentAmount |
+--------------+------------------------+
| 3 | 0.214847 |
| 26 | 0.219357 |
| 24 | 0.224337 |
| 5 | 0.224337 |
| 18 | 0.224337 |
| 28 | 0.214847 |
| 1 | 0.224337 |
| 28 | 0.327079 |
+--------------+------------------------+
I am looking for a query that would then give something like;
+--------------+------------------------+
| RepaymentDay | MonthlyRepaymentAmount |
+--------------+------------------------+
| 1 | 0.224337 |
| 3 | 0.214847 |
| 5 | 0.224337 |
| 18 | 0.224337 |
| 24 | 0.224337 |
| 26 | 0.219357 |
| 28 | 0.541926 |
+--------------+------------------------+
I.e Where there are multiple records with the same value of 'RepaymentDay' , to sum those values of 'MonthlyRepaymentAmount'.
I could do it externally with perl or python, no issue, but I want to try and become more familiar with SQL.
Any ideas?
SELECT RepaymentDay, SUM(MonthlyRepaymentAmount) AS MonthlyRepaymentAmount
FROM YourTable
GROUP BY RepaymentDay
ORDER BY RepaymentDay
